Doubletree by Hilton declares ?Free Cookies for All?

Today DoubleTree by Hilton is taking Chocolate Chip Cookie Day global with an international cookie blitz to surprise unsuspecting travellers with tens of thousands of the brand?s chocolate chip and walnut cookies ? the same signature greeting that is offered to each guest at check-in.

DoubleTree by Hilton invites anyone to walk into any of its hotels around the world for a free cookie throughout the day ? with or without a reservation.

John Greenleaf, global head of the chain, said: ?We believe that no matter where you are or what you are doing, cookies have the power to make you smile. It?s the reason we?ve welcomed guests with a warm chocolate chip cookie for more than 25 years. Celebrating a fun, light-hearted holiday like Chocolate Chip Cookie Day is just another way we strive to surprise and delight travellers and make their journey sweeter.?

The company has also teamed up with transportation partners, including Virgin Atlantic at London?s Gatwick and Heathrow Airports, to brighten travellers? days with free cookies and will launch a ?Cookie Bag Vote,? inviting consumers to help select a brand-new packaging design.
